416 Rigby powder using Barnes 400 Grs TSX

H-4350 with 350 and 400gr TSX's, I loaded mine to near 416 WBY levels, you can start if you wish with a chronograph and 94gr H-4350 under 400gr TSX, work up to what your rifle and shoulder likes ; ]

I used Norma brass and FED-215 primers, a very versatile and powerful hunting round with rich, rich African hunting history, one of my all time favorites, if a man was so inclined, 350gr TTSX's at 2800+ fps is a 400 yard ALL game ANYWHERE load.
 
The 416 Rigby is so versatile that you can lean on it or throttle back a bit and get great results on anything. My Dakota likes 92.0 grains of H4350 with 400 TSX and the loads are never an issue in hot weather. I have never recovered one on buff. If you limited me to one gun/load in Africa, that would be it. I have thought about playing with the 350 TSX but so far I'm real happy with the 400's.
 
I have found that my rifle like H4350 the best.
 
H and IMR 4350 for me. In my rifle H gives me an edge with groups. But not enough to not use IMR if needed.
91 grains of H4350 happiness for me. May need to go to 93 with the TSX but the Rigby has plenty of headroom.
 
That 92.0 range plus or minus has been good for many with 400 TSX in the Rigby. You will shoot through buff.
 
I use AR2209 (Re packaged as H4350) in my 416 Rigby. This throws 400 and 410 grain soft points and 400 grain Woodleigh Hydros to the same point of impact. 94 grains of AR2209 gives me 2250fps for the soft and 2550 for the Hydros. If you use AR2213sc (H4831sc) it has a harder recoil then the faster powder.
